The journey to discovering endometrial ablation often begins with a diagnosis of menorrhagia. Women experiencing prolonged or excessive menstrual bleeding may undergo various tests to rule out underlying conditions such as fibroids, polyps, or cancer. When conservative treatments fail to provide relief, ablation becomes a viable option. The procedure involves removing or destroying the lining of the uterus, known as the endometrium, which is responsible for menstrual bleeding. By reducing the endometrial lining, ablation significantly decreases or stops menstrual bleeding altogether.
Understanding Uterine Endometrial Ablation
Uterine endometrial ablation is a minimally invasive procedure that can be performed on an outpatient basis. The process typically begins with a thorough examination and consultation with a healthcare provider to determine if ablation is the right course of treatment. On the day of the procedure, patients are usually given local anesthesia and possibly sedation to ensure comfort during the process.
The technique used for ablation may vary, but common methods include:
- Microwave ablation: Utilizes microwave energy to heat and destroy the endometrial lining.
- Radiofrequency ablation: Employs radiofrequency energy to achieve similar results.
- Balloon ablation: Involves inflating a balloon within the uterus and using heated fluid to ablate the lining.
- Hydrothermal ablation: Uses heated fluid to destroy the endometrium.
Each method aims to reduce menstrual bleeding by ablating the endometrial lining. The choice of technique depends on various factors, including the size and shape of the uterus, the presence of any fibroids, and the patient's overall health.
Benefits and Outcomes
The benefits of uterine endometrial ablation are numerous. One of the most significant advantages is the potential for a substantial reduction or complete cessation of menstrual bleeding. Studies have shown that:
| Outcome | Percentage of Patients |
|---|---|
| Significant reduction in bleeding | 85-90% |
| Complete cessation of bleeding | 40-50% |
| Improvement in quality of life | 90-95% |
These outcomes highlight the effectiveness of ablation in addressing menorrhagia and improving patients' quality of life. Additionally, the procedure is minimally invasive, often resulting in less pain and quicker recovery times compared to more invasive surgical options like hysterectomy.
Considerations and Potential Side Effects
While uterine endometrial ablation is a highly effective treatment for menorrhagia, it is essential to consider potential side effects and limitations. Some women may experience:
- Temporary cramping or discomfort
- Vaginal discharge or spotting
- Infection or bleeding complications
It is also crucial to note that ablation is not suitable for everyone, particularly those who:
- Are pregnant or wish to become pregnant
- Have a current or suspected pregnancy
- Have certain medical conditions, such as cancer or infection
Long-Term Implications and Future Considerations
Uterine endometrial ablation is considered a long-term solution for menorrhagia, but it is not a permanent cure. Some women may experience a return of heavy bleeding over time. Additionally, ablation does not eliminate the possibility of pregnancy, although it is not recommended for women who wish to conceive in the future. In some cases, pregnancy after ablation can lead to complications, and careful consideration is necessary.
Future considerations should include:
- Regular follow-up with a healthcare provider to monitor menstrual cycles and overall health
- Awareness of potential complications or recurrence of symptoms
- Discussion of alternative or additional treatments if needed
